Spider-Man: A History of Adaptations
From his initial comic debut in 1962, Spider-Man's story has been brought to life across a wide range of media. Early television series and animated cartoons established the character's popularity, while later attempts at a feature film faced various challenges. The groundbreaking Sam Raimi trilogy in the early 2000s redefined the superhero genre, followed by the successful but distinctly different Marvel Cinematic Universe iterations. More recently, we've seen animated films like "Spider-Man: Into the Spider-Verse" pushing creative boundaries, and various video games have allowed players to experience the world through Peter Parker's eyes. The ever-evolving legacy of Spider-Man continues to inspire new and exciting adaptations for future generations.

Our Friendly Neighborhood Spider-Man and the Direction of the Marvel Universe
The re-emergence of Spider-Man into the Marvel Cinematic Universe , following the tricky circumstance with copyright, has undeniably altered the field of possibilities for the franchise’s future strategies . While his first appearances offered fun moments, the ongoing integration of Peter Parker and his dimension creates fascinating opportunities regarding parallel storytelling and potential team-ups with current heroes. The triumph of *No Way Home* proved the strength of merging distinct timelines, but cautiously managing this approach will be critical to ensuring the lasting viability of the Marvel Universe and avoiding story fatigue .
